12 2012 档案

摘要:static void Main(String[] args) { Console.WriteLine("--------"); string myconn = "Database='test';Data Source=localhost;User ID=root;Password=123456;CharSet=utf8;"; //需要执行的SQL语句 string mysql = "SELECT * from users"; //创建数据库连接 M... 阅读全文
posted @ 2012-12-19 13:52 残星 阅读(2079) 评论(1) 推荐(0) 编辑
摘要:// Java example code to create a new file try { File file = new File("path and file_name"); boolean success = file.createNewFile(); } catch (IOException e) { }// Java example code to delete a file. try { File file = new File("path and file_name"); ... 阅读全文
posted @ 2012-12-17 16:20 残星 阅读(264) 评论(0) 推荐(0) 编辑
摘要:步骤一:下载MySql驱动包官方下载地址是http://dev.mysql.com/downloads/connector/net步骤二:引入组件下载的文件是一个压缩文件,将其解压缩到本地磁盘。找到bin文件夹中的MySql.Data.dll文件,这个就是我们要引用的组件。通过Visual Studio将其引用到你的项目中部署dll流程:首先把dll文件放到应用程序...\bin\Debug\下;然后在解决方案中添加引用:右键鼠标-->添加引用-->浏览-->选择dll放置路径后点击“确定”。注意:要在应用文件头处使用using MySql.Data.MySqlClient; 阅读全文
posted @ 2012-12-17 14:07 残星 阅读(27796) 评论(4) 推荐(1) 编辑
摘要:Math 对象Math 对象用于执行数学任务。Math 对象属性属性描述FFIEE返回算术常量 e,即自然对数的底数(约等于2.718)。13LN2返回 2 的自然对数(约等于0.693)。13LN10返回 10 的自然对数(约等于2.302)。13LOG2E返回以 2 为底的 e 的对数(约等于 1.414)。13LOG10E返回以 10 为底的 e 的对数(约等于0.434)。13PI返回圆周率(约等于3.14159)。13SQRT1_2返回返回 2 的平方根的倒数(约等于 0.707)。13SQRT2返回 2 的平方根(约等于 1.414)。13Math 对象方法方法描述FFIEabs( 阅读全文
posted @ 2012-12-14 10:24 残星 阅读(192) 评论(0) 推荐(0) 编辑
摘要:if(item.style.display == "block"){jQuery(item).slideToggle(500,function(){jQuery(item).prev().toggleClass("active");});//item.style.display = "none";}else{jQuery(item).slideToggle(500,function(){jQuery(item).prev().toggleClass("active");});//item.style.display 阅读全文
posted @ 2012-12-07 10:27 残星 阅读(180) 评论(0) 推荐(0) 编辑
摘要:def export csv_string = FasterCSV.generate do |csv| csv 'text/csv;',:disposition => "attachment; filename=product.csv" enddef self.import_db(f... 阅读全文
posted @ 2012-12-07 09:34 残星 阅读(775) 评论(0) 推荐(0) 编辑
摘要:webview ,用网页来布局。 Android 的 webview 是基于 webkit 内核,不过他的运行效果和 firefox 上一模一样,所以写的时候都是先用 firefox 测试,测试 OK 了再放到程序里面看效果,基本上不会有什么问题。其实 android 的 webview 跟 iphone 的 webview 差不多, iphone 上的 webview 比 android 上的强大多了。谈一下研究 webview 的一些成果:一. 加载资源的速度不慢,但是资源多了,就很慢。图片、 css 、 js 、 html 这些资源每个大概需要 10-200ms ,一般都是 30ms 就 阅读全文
posted @ 2012-12-06 15:47 残星 阅读(5524) 评论(0) 推荐(0) 编辑
摘要:JDK + Eclipse + Android SDK + ADT1 必须软件Java JDK SE 1.6+ (jdk-7u9-windows-i586.exe)Eclipse (Eclipse IDE for Java Developers)Google Android SDK (android-sdk_r15-windows.zip)ADT (ADT-15.0.0.zip)如果找不到可参考:http://blog.csdn.net/zhenyongyuan123/article/details/60609002.安装过程(1)安装JDK (2).解压Eclipse(3)解压Google. 阅读全文
posted @ 2012-12-04 14:33 残星 阅读(217) 评论(0) 推荐(0) 编辑
摘要:Eclipse 是一个开放源代码的、基于 Java 的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。幸运的是,Eclipse 附带了一个标准的插件集,包括 Java 开发工具(Java Development Tools,JDT)。 当我们需要使用Eclipse的一些扩展功能时,我们除了使用方法一:将Eclipse的插件下载下来放在其安装目录的plugins文件夹外,有时因为功能需求,资源局限,版本不一致等诸多因素的影响,我们将采用方法二,在线安装我们所需要的插件。 经常性的,在要安装Eclipse插件的时候,我都找不到Help->So... 阅读全文
posted @ 2012-12-04 14:30 残星 阅读(5887) 评论(0) 推荐(0) 编辑
摘要:安装XML Buildergem install builderclass CatalogController "1.0" @xml.catalogs{ for catalog in @catalogs @xml.catalog do @xml.journal(catalog.journal) @xml.publisher(catalog.publisher) @xml.edition(catalog.edition) @xml.title(catalog.title) @xml.author(catalog.author) end ... 阅读全文
posted @ 2012-12-03 13:53 残星 阅读(204) 评论(0) 推荐(0) 编辑
摘要:$! 最近一次的错误信息$@ 错误产生的位置$_ gets最近读的字符串$. 解释器最近读的行数(line number)$& 最近一次与正则表达式匹配的字符串$~ 作为子表达式组的最近一次匹配$n 最近匹配的第n个子表达式(和$~[n]一样)$= 是否区别大小写的标志$/ 输入记录分隔符$\ 输出记录分隔符$0 Ruby脚本的文件名$* 命令行参数$$ 解释器进程ID$? 最近一次执行的子进程退出状态 阅读全文
posted @ 2012-12-03 11:18 残星 阅读(522) 评论(0) 推荐(0) 编辑
摘要:在进行导入或上传文件时需要创建临时目录以存放临时文件,这时就需要动态创建目录了。在windows中因为权限不那么严格,所以创建目录时可以不指定目录的访问权限,但在linux环境下就不行了,只有正确的指定了目录的访问权限,才能正常地处理文件操作,否则可能出现权限不足的错误file_path = "#{RAILS_ROOT}/public/tmp/csv" FileUtils.mkdir_p(file_path, :mode => 0777)一定要注意正确指定mode的值,否则可能导致权限不足的问题。一般来说使用系统的默认值就可以了,但如果有需要,最好还是加上权限设置。 阅读全文
posted @ 2012-12-03 11:15 残星 阅读(1217) 评论(0) 推荐(0) 编辑
摘要:1、使用dba权限登录2、建表 阅读全文
posted @ 2012-12-03 11:07 残星 阅读(406) 评论(0) 推荐(0) 编辑
摘要:首先在application_helper.rb文件下加入下面两个方法#error_messages_for方法修改 def error_messages_for(*params) options = params.last.is_a?(Hash) ? params.pop.symbolize_keys : {} objects = params.collect {|object_name| instance_variable_get("@#{object_name}") }.compact error_messages = objects.map do |object| 阅读全文
posted @ 2012-12-03 10:44 残星 阅读(352) 评论(0) 推荐(0) 编辑
摘要:function getOs(){ var OsObject = ""; if (navigator.userAgent.indexOf("MSIE") > 0) { return "MSIE"; } if (isFirefox = navigator.userAgent.indexOf("Firefox") > 0) { return "Firefox"; } if (isSafari = navigator.userAgent.indexOf("Safari" 阅读全文
posted @ 2012-12-03 09:39 残星 阅读(195) 评论(0) 推荐(0) 编辑